BeBe, a young girl who lived in the North Carolina mountains with her father, was never allowed to date when she was a young woman. Her mother had passed away with an illness when BeBe was four. Throughout her younger years, BeBe made friends with many, many wild animals. Her father passed away when she was nineteen. He left her with a cabin in the mountains and apparently no funds to help her support herself. James was a hunter who lived close to Jacksonville, Florida. During hunting season, he always joined other hunters in a hunting club in South Georgia to hunt. One year, he decided to go to the mountains in North Carolina to try out his luck there.
